匯編語(yǔ)言與計(jì)算機(jī)系統(tǒng)組成
定 價(jià):44 元
叢書(shū)名:普通高等教育“十一五”計(jì)算機(jī)類(lèi)規(guī)劃教材
- 作者:李心廣 等編著
- 出版時(shí)間:2009/7/1
- ISBN:9787111268680
- 出 版 社:機(jī)械工業(yè)出版社
- 中圖法分類(lèi):TP303
- 頁(yè)碼:397
- 紙張:膠版紙
- 版次:1
- 開(kāi)本:16開(kāi)
本書(shū)將“匯編語(yǔ)言程序設(shè)計(jì)”、“計(jì)算機(jī)組成原理”及“計(jì)算機(jī)體系結(jié)構(gòu)”有機(jī)地結(jié)合于一體。在保證必要的經(jīng)典內(nèi)容的同時(shí),力求反映近代理論和先進(jìn)技術(shù);在理論與應(yīng)用關(guān)系上,力求實(shí)用,以應(yīng)用為主。
本書(shū)共分4篇:第1篇為計(jì)算機(jī)系統(tǒng)組成基礎(chǔ),內(nèi)容包括計(jì)算機(jī)系統(tǒng)概論、計(jì)算機(jī)中的信息表示與運(yùn)算方法。第2篇為計(jì)算機(jī)系統(tǒng)分層結(jié)構(gòu),內(nèi)容包括CPU組織、指令系統(tǒng)層、80x86匯編語(yǔ)言程序設(shè)計(jì)。第3篇為存儲(chǔ)系統(tǒng)與輸入/輸出系統(tǒng),內(nèi)容包括存儲(chǔ)系統(tǒng)介紹、輸入/輸出系統(tǒng)、計(jì)算機(jī)I/O設(shè)備。第4篇為計(jì)算機(jī)系統(tǒng)部件設(shè)計(jì)。
本書(shū)可作為高等院校計(jì)算機(jī)類(lèi)、自動(dòng)控制及電子技術(shù)應(yīng)用等專(zhuān)業(yè)的教材;也可作為其他理工電氣信息類(lèi)專(zhuān)業(yè)教材;還可供從事相關(guān)專(zhuān)業(yè)的工程技術(shù)人員作為參考書(shū)。
前言
第1篇 計(jì)算機(jī)系統(tǒng)組成基礎(chǔ)
第1章 計(jì)算機(jī)系統(tǒng)概論
1.1 計(jì)算機(jī)的基本概念
1.1.1 存儲(chǔ)程序的工作方式
1.1.2 信息的數(shù)字化表示
1.1.3 計(jì)算機(jī)體系結(jié)構(gòu)、組成與實(shí)現(xiàn)
1.2 計(jì)算機(jī)系統(tǒng)的硬、軟件組成
1.2.1 計(jì)算機(jī)硬件系統(tǒng)
1.2.2 計(jì)算機(jī)軟件系統(tǒng)
1.3 層次結(jié)構(gòu)模型
1.3.1 從語(yǔ)言功能角度劃分層次結(jié)構(gòu)
1.3.2 軟、硬件在邏輯上的等價(jià)
1.4 計(jì)算機(jī)的工作過(guò)程
1.4.1 處理問(wèn)題的步驟 前言
第1篇 計(jì)算機(jī)系統(tǒng)組成基礎(chǔ)
第1章 計(jì)算機(jī)系統(tǒng)概論
1.1 計(jì)算機(jī)的基本概念
1.1.1 存儲(chǔ)程序的工作方式
1.1.2 信息的數(shù)字化表示
1.1.3 計(jì)算機(jī)體系結(jié)構(gòu)、組成與實(shí)現(xiàn)
1.2 計(jì)算機(jī)系統(tǒng)的硬、軟件組成
1.2.1 計(jì)算機(jī)硬件系統(tǒng)
1.2.2 計(jì)算機(jī)軟件系統(tǒng)
1.3 層次結(jié)構(gòu)模型
1.3.1 從語(yǔ)言功能角度劃分層次結(jié)構(gòu)
1.3.2 軟、硬件在邏輯上的等價(jià)
1.4 計(jì)算機(jī)的工作過(guò)程
1.4.1 處理問(wèn)題的步驟
1.4.2 計(jì)算機(jī)的解題過(guò)程
1.5 微型計(jì)算機(jī)的主要技術(shù)指標(biāo)
1.6 計(jì)算機(jī)的發(fā)展與應(yīng)用
1.6.1 電子計(jì)算機(jī)的誕生
1.6.2 第一代計(jì)算機(jī)
1.6.3 第二代計(jì)算機(jī)
1.6.4 第三代計(jì)算機(jī)
1.6.5 第四代計(jì)算機(jī)
1.6.6 新一代計(jì)算機(jī)
1.6.7 我國(guó)計(jì)算機(jī)的發(fā)展
思考題與習(xí)題
第2章 計(jì)算機(jī)中的信息表示
2.1 無(wú)符號(hào)數(shù)和有符號(hào)數(shù)
2.1.1 無(wú)符號(hào)數(shù)
2.1.2 有符號(hào)數(shù)
2.2 數(shù)的定點(diǎn)表示和浮點(diǎn)表示
2.2.1 定點(diǎn)表示
2.2.2 浮點(diǎn)表示
2.2.3 定點(diǎn)數(shù)和浮點(diǎn)數(shù)的比較
2.2.4 舉例
2.2.5 IEEE 754
2.3 定點(diǎn)運(yùn)算
2.3.1 移位運(yùn)算
2.3.2 加法與減法運(yùn)算
2.3.3 乘法運(yùn)算
2.3.4 除法運(yùn)算
2.4 浮點(diǎn)四則運(yùn)算
2.4.1 浮點(diǎn)加減運(yùn)算
2.4.2 浮點(diǎn)乘除運(yùn)算
2.4.3 浮點(diǎn)運(yùn)算所需的硬件配置
2.5 算術(shù)邏輯單元
2.5.1 ALU電路
2.5.2 快速進(jìn)位鏈
2.6 字符的表示
2.6.1 ASCIl碼
2.6.2 Unicode編碼
2.6.3 漢字編碼簡(jiǎn)介
2.7 指令信息的表示
2.7.1 指令格式
2.7.2 常用的尋址方式
2.7.3 指令類(lèi)型
2.7.4 Pentium指令格式
2.8 校驗(yàn)技術(shù)
2.8.1 奇偶校驗(yàn)碼
2.8.2 循環(huán)冗余校驗(yàn)碼
思考題與習(xí)題
第2篇 計(jì)算機(jī)系統(tǒng)分層結(jié)構(gòu)
第3章 微體系結(jié)構(gòu)層——CPU的構(gòu)成
3.1 CPU的組成和功能
3.1.1 CPU的組成
3.1.2 CPU的功能
3.1.3 指令的執(zhí)行過(guò)程
3.2 CPU模型機(jī)的數(shù)據(jù)通路及指令流程分析
3.2.1 單總線(xiàn)結(jié)構(gòu)
3.2.2 雙總線(xiàn)結(jié)構(gòu)
3.2.3 三總線(xiàn)結(jié)構(gòu)
……
第4章 指令系統(tǒng)層
第5章 匯編語(yǔ)言層
第3篇 存儲(chǔ)系統(tǒng)與輸入/輸出系統(tǒng)
第6章 存儲(chǔ)系統(tǒng)
第7章 輸入/輸出系統(tǒng)
第8章 I/O設(shè)備
第4篇 計(jì)算機(jī)系統(tǒng)部件設(shè)計(jì)
第9章 現(xiàn)代計(jì)算機(jī)系統(tǒng)部件設(shè)計(jì)
參考文獻(xiàn)
第1篇 計(jì)算機(jī)系統(tǒng)組成基礎(chǔ)
第1章 計(jì)算機(jī)系統(tǒng)概論
本章介紹計(jì)算機(jī)系統(tǒng)組成的基本概念,計(jì)算機(jī)中的信息表示,計(jì)算機(jī)系統(tǒng)的硬、軟件組成,計(jì)算機(jī)的層次結(jié)構(gòu),計(jì)算機(jī)的工作過(guò)程,數(shù)字計(jì)算機(jī)的特點(diǎn)與性能指標(biāo),計(jì)算機(jī)的發(fā)展與應(yīng)用。
1.1 計(jì)算機(jī)的基本概念
電子計(jì)算機(jī)是一種不需要人工直接干預(yù),能夠自動(dòng)、高速、準(zhǔn)確地對(duì)各種信息進(jìn)行處理和存儲(chǔ)的電子設(shè)備。電子計(jì)算機(jī)從總體上來(lái)說(shuō)可以分為兩大類(lèi):電子模擬計(jì)算機(jī)和電子數(shù)字計(jì)算機(jī)。電子模擬計(jì)算機(jī)中處理的信息是連續(xù)變化的物理量,運(yùn)算的過(guò)程也是連續(xù)的;而電子數(shù)字計(jì)算機(jī)中處理的信息在時(shí)間上是離散的數(shù)字量,運(yùn)算的過(guò)程是不連續(xù)的。通常所說(shuō)的計(jì)算機(jī)都是指電子數(shù)字計(jì)算機(jī)。
1.1.1 存儲(chǔ)程序的工作方式
計(jì)算機(jī)系統(tǒng)由硬件系統(tǒng)和軟件系統(tǒng)兩大部分組成。美籍匈牙利科學(xué)家馮·諾依曼(John voll Neumann)奠定了現(xiàn)代計(jì)算機(jī)的基本結(jié)構(gòu),其特點(diǎn)是:
1)使用單一的處理部件來(lái)完成計(jì)算、存儲(chǔ)以及通信的工作。
2)存儲(chǔ)單元是定長(zhǎng)的線(xiàn)性組織。
3)存儲(chǔ)空間的單元是直接尋址的。
4)使用低級(jí)機(jī)器語(yǔ)言,指令通過(guò)操作碼來(lái)完成簡(jiǎn)單的操作。
5)對(duì)計(jì)算進(jìn)行集中的順序控制。
6)計(jì)算機(jī)硬件系統(tǒng)由運(yùn)算器、存儲(chǔ)器、控制器、輸入設(shè)備、輸出設(shè)備五大部件組成,并規(guī)定了它們的基本功能。
7)以二進(jìn)制形式表示數(shù)據(jù)和指令。
8)在執(zhí)行程序和處理數(shù)據(jù)時(shí)必須將程序和數(shù)據(jù)從外存儲(chǔ)器裝入主存儲(chǔ)器中,然后才能使計(jì)算機(jī)在工作時(shí)能夠自動(dòng)從存儲(chǔ)器中取出指令并加以執(zhí)行。
這就是存儲(chǔ)程序概念的基本原理。
……